huanayun
hengtianyun
vps567
莱卡云

[Linux操作系统]在openSUSE上搭建Node.js开发环境详解|nodejs openssl,openSUSE Node.js 环境,在openSUSE系统中详尽搭建Node.js开发环境教程,openssl与Node.js环境配置指南

PikPak

推荐阅读:

[AI-人工智能]免翻墙的AI利器:樱桃茶·智域GPT,让你轻松使用ChatGPT和Midjourney - 免费AIGC工具 - 拼车/合租账号 八折优惠码: AIGCJOEDISCOUNT2024

[AI-人工智能]银河录像局: 国内可靠的AI工具与流媒体的合租平台 高效省钱、现号秒发、翻车赔偿、无限续费|95折优惠码: AIGCJOE

[AI-人工智能]免梯免翻墙-ChatGPT拼车站月卡 | 可用GPT4/GPT4o/o1-preview | 会话隔离 | 全网最低价独享体验ChatGPT/Claude会员服务

[AI-人工智能]边界AICHAT - 超级永久终身会员激活 史诗级神器,口碑炸裂!300万人都在用的AI平台

本文详细介绍了在openSUSE Linux操作系统上搭建Node.js开发环境的步骤,包括安Node.js、openssl等相关依赖。通过逐步指导,帮助开发者快速搭建起高效的Node.js开发环境。

本文目录导读:

  1. openSUSE简介
  2. 安装Node.js环境
  3. 配置Node.js环境
  4. Node.js项目开发

随着开源技术的不断发展,Node.js作为一种高性能的服务器端JavaScript运行环境,得到了广泛的关注和应用,本文将详细介绍如何在openSUSE操作系统上搭建Node.js开发环境,帮助开发者快速上手。

openSUSE简介

openSUSE是一款德国的开源操作系统,基于SUSE Linux,拥有强大的社区支持,它提供了稳定、安全、易用的操作系统环境,适用于服务器、桌面和开发等多种场景。

安装Node.js环境

1、更新系统软件包

在开始安装Node.js之前,首先需要确保系统软件包是最新的,打开终端,执行以命令:

sudo zypper refresh
sudo zypper update

2、安装Node.js

openSUSE默认仓库中不包含Node.js,因此我们需要添加NodeSource的仓库,执行以下命令:

sudo zypper addrepo --refresh --name "NodeSource" https://deb.nodesource.com/setup_16.x

然后安装Node.js:

sudo zypper install nodejs

安装完成后,可以通过以下命令检查Node.js的版本:

node -v

3、安装npm

npm是Node.js的包管理工具,可以通过以下命令安装:

sudo zypper install npm

安装完成后,可以通过以下命令检查npm的版本:

npm -v

配置Node.js环境

1、创建全局模块目录

在openSUSE中,全局模块默认安装在/usr/lib/node_modules目录下,为了方便管理,我们可以创建一个自定义的全局模块目录,并修改环境变量。

创建自定义目录:

mkdir -p ~/node_modules_global

修改环境变量:

echo 'export PATH="$PATH:~/node_modules_global/bin"' >> ~/.bashrc
source ~/.bashrc

2、使用nvm管理Node.js版本

nvm(Node Version Manager)是一个管理Node.js版本的工具,通过nvm,我们可以轻松切换不同版本的Node.js。

安装nvm:

curl -o- https://raw.githubusercontent.com/nvm-sh/nvm/v0.39.1/install.sh | bash

安装完成后,重新打开终端或执行source ~/.bashrc,然后使用以下命令安装不同版本的Node.js:

nvm install 14.15.5
nvm use 14.15.5

Node.js项目开发

1、创建项目目录

在终端中创建一个新目录,用于存放项目文件:

mkdir my_project
cd my_project

2、初始化项目

在项目目录中,执行以下命令初始化项目:

npm init -y

该命令会创建一个package.json文件,其中包含了项目的配置信息。

3、安装依赖

package.json文件中,我们可以添加项目所需的依赖,如果需要安装Express框架,可以执行以下命令:

npm install express

4、编写代码

在项目目录中,创建一个名为app.js的文件,并编写以下代码:

const express = require('express');
const app = express();
app.get('/', (req, res) => {
  res.send('Hello, World!');
});
app.listen(3000, () => {
  console.log('Server is running on port 3000');
});

5、运行项目

在终端中,执行以下命令启动项目:

node app.js

打开浏览器,访问http://localhost:3000,即可看到项目运行结果。

本文详细介绍了在openSUSE上搭建Node.js开发环境的过程,包括更新系统软件包、安装Node.js和npm、配置环境变量、使用nvm管理Node.js版本以及创建和运行Node.js项目,通过这篇文章,开发者可以快速上手Node.js开发。

以下为50个中文相关关键词:

openSUSE, Node.js, 开发环境, 搭建, 安装, 系统软件包, 更新, NodeSource, 仓库, 版本, 检查, 包管理工具, 配置, 全局模块, 目录, 环境变量, nvm, 版本管理, 项目, 初始化, 依赖, 代码, 运行, 服务器, 框架, Express, 浏览器, 访问, 端口, 监听, 模块, 服务器端, JavaScript, 运行环境, 高性能, 开源, 操作系统, 德国, 社区支持, 稳定, 安全, 易用, 终端, 命令, 脚本, 环境变量, 服务器端开发, 服务器端编程

bwg Vultr justhost.asia racknerd hostkvm pesyun Pawns


本文标签属性:

Node.js:nodejs和vue的关系

openSUSE:openSUSE中文社区

openSUSE Node.js 环境:nodejs开发环境

原文链接:,转发请注明来源!